Organic Recycling Systems Secures Major EPC Contract for CBG Project in Madhya Pradesh Worth ₹50-100 Crores
Organic Recycling Systems Limited has won a significant EPC contract valued at ₹50-100 crores for developing a Compressed Bio-Gas project in Madhya Pradesh. The project involves constructing a 10 TPD CBG facility in Damoh and forms part of an ambitious expansion plan worth ₹500-600 crores covering 10 integrated projects across the state over three years.

Organic Recycling Systems Limited (ORSL) has announced securing a significant large-scale EPC contract for a Compressed Bio-Gas (CBG) project in Madhya Pradesh, valued between ₹50-100 crores. The Bioenergy Project Development and EPC vertical of the company won the contract from Shreyam Manek Agro Products Pvt. Ltd. on February 24, 2026.
Project Details and Specifications
The contract involves construction of a state-of-the-art Integrated Compressed Bio-Gas (CBG) and biofertilizer project in Damoh, Madhya Pradesh. The facility is designed with specific technical parameters and strategic positioning.
| Parameter: | Details |
|---|---|
| Production Capacity: | 10 TPD (Tons Per Day) of CBG |
| Feedstock Type: | Agro feedstock |
| Location: | Damoh, Madhya Pradesh |
| Integration: | Part of larger integrated modern gaushala |
| Project Type: | Large-scale order (₹50-100 Crores) |
Scope of Work and Execution
Under this contract, ORSL will undertake comprehensive project execution responsibilities. The company's scope includes equity participation and end-to-end EPC execution, encompassing detailed engineering, technology integration, supply of critical equipment, construction, installation, and commissioning of the facility.
Strategic Expansion Plan
This project represents part of a larger strategic collaboration with significant expansion implications. The current contract is one component of an ambitious deployment plan spanning multiple locations across Madhya Pradesh.
| Expansion Parameter: | Details |
|---|---|
| Total Projects Planned: | 10 integrated projects |
| Geographic Coverage: | Various locations in Madhya Pradesh |
| Total Investment Outlay: | ₹500-600 Crores |
| Implementation Timeline: | 3 years |
